Felipe Massa: “This definitely wasn’t the greatest result”

Felipe Massa admitted he was both disappointed and surprised to find himself eliminated from qualifying before the top ten shootout, and will start in his lowest ever grid slot for his home Grand Prix at the Autódromo José Carlos Pace. The Williams Martini Racing driver went into the qualifying session expecting to be inside the top ten after good pace throughout practice, but it was not to be as tyre struggles restricted his lap times, and he will start thirteenth as a result.
